PURPOSE OF REPORT<br />

To c<strong>on</strong>sider a request for the proposed reloc<strong>at</strong>i<strong>on</strong> <str<strong>on</strong>g>of</str<strong>on</strong>g> a Council s<str<strong>on</strong>g>to</str<strong>on</strong>g>rmw<strong>at</strong>er drainage pipeline and<br />

easement loc<strong>at</strong>ed within No 15 Pears<strong>on</strong> Avenue, Gord<strong>on</strong>.<br />

BACKGROUND<br />

The applicant, Quirante Holdings Pty Ltd, submitted a Development Applic<strong>at</strong>i<strong>on</strong> (DA No.177/03)<br />

<str<strong>on</strong>g>to</str<strong>on</strong>g> Council for a dual occupancy development <strong>at</strong> 15 Pears<strong>on</strong> Avenue Gord<strong>on</strong>. As a c<strong>on</strong>sequence <str<strong>on</strong>g>of</str<strong>on</strong>g><br />

the Land and Envir<strong>on</strong>ment Court proceedings No.11324 <str<strong>on</strong>g>of</str<strong>on</strong>g> 2003, the development was approved by<br />

Commissi<strong>on</strong>er Bly <strong>on</strong> 16 March 2004.<br />

Granting <str<strong>on</strong>g>of</str<strong>on</strong>g> the development was subject <str<strong>on</strong>g>to</str<strong>on</strong>g> the c<strong>on</strong>diti<strong>on</strong>s in Annexure ‘A’ <str<strong>on</strong>g>of</str<strong>on</strong>g> the proceedings<br />

(Attachment 1) comprising three s<str<strong>on</strong>g>to</str<strong>on</strong>g>rmw<strong>at</strong>er drainage pre-commencement c<strong>on</strong>diti<strong>on</strong>s:<br />

• Requirement <str<strong>on</strong>g>to</str<strong>on</strong>g> vary the terms <str<strong>on</strong>g>of</str<strong>on</strong>g> the easement in No.17 Pears<strong>on</strong>, downstream.<br />

• Formalise the drainage works proposed in No.15 Pears<strong>on</strong> Avenue by submissi<strong>on</strong> <str<strong>on</strong>g>of</str<strong>on</strong>g> design plans<br />

• Requirement for Road Opening applic<strong>at</strong>i<strong>on</strong> for works in Burgoyne Street.<br />

The applicant has submitted revised s<str<strong>on</strong>g>to</str<strong>on</strong>g>rmw<strong>at</strong>er plans and details, drawings GD 2.1 and GD 2.2,<br />

Revisi<strong>on</strong> C d<strong>at</strong>ed February 2003, and GD 2.4 Revisi<strong>on</strong> C d<strong>at</strong>ed June 2003, GD 2.5 and GD 2.6<br />

Revisi<strong>on</strong> C d<strong>at</strong>ed August 2004, prepared by K.R Stubbs & Associ<strong>at</strong>es Pty Ltd.<br />

COMMENTS<br />

Current situ<strong>at</strong>i<strong>on</strong><br />

S<str<strong>on</strong>g>to</str<strong>on</strong>g>rmw<strong>at</strong>er run<str<strong>on</strong>g>of</str<strong>on</strong>g>f from Burgoyne Street and Pears<strong>on</strong> Avenue c<strong>on</strong>verge in road pits <strong>on</strong> the southern<br />

boundary <str<strong>on</strong>g>of</str<strong>on</strong>g> No.15 which is then c<strong>on</strong>veyed downstream by a 450mm diameter pipe. The pipe<br />

travels near the eastern boundary across No.15 in<str<strong>on</strong>g>to</str<strong>on</strong>g> No.17, discharging in<str<strong>on</strong>g>to</str<strong>on</strong>g> a n<strong>at</strong>ural gully about 6<br />

metres <str<strong>on</strong>g>be</str<strong>on</strong>g>fore the northern boundary <str<strong>on</strong>g>of</str<strong>on</strong>g> No.17, as shown <strong>on</strong> drainage layout plan, Attachment 2.<br />

Pits near the southern boundary <str<strong>on</strong>g>of</str<strong>on</strong>g> No.15 are loc<strong>at</strong>ed in the road sag <str<strong>on</strong>g>of</str<strong>on</strong>g> Burgoyne Street. As such,<br />

overflows in excess <str<strong>on</strong>g>of</str<strong>on</strong>g> the public drainage system, over<str<strong>on</strong>g>to</str<strong>on</strong>g>p the kerb and run<str<strong>on</strong>g>of</str<strong>on</strong>g>f overland across<br />

No.15 in a northerly directi<strong>on</strong> over the gully coinciding with the pipe.<br />
